£80,000 per annum (pro-rated for part time) Excellent benefits Full remote working (one day per quarter in London) Our client is on the hunt for a Compliance Consultant to assist financial sector clients understand their regulatory obligations, to research and write updates on new compliance requirements, and to ensure their team of regulatory reporters are on top of current rules. Knowledge and experience of working with financial regulations is required, and since the client assists firms in UK, US & Europe any exposure to those jurisdictions will be beneficial. Must have experience in regulatory reporting requirements for investment firms such as AIFMD, IFPR in UK/ Europe and/ or US SEC reporting. CLIENT CONSULTANCY Candidates must be confident discussing regulatory compliance issues with fund manager and fund service provider clients, as well as addressing queries they may raise by phone or email. Relevant regulators include but are not limited to the UK FCA, Central Bank of Ireland, Luxembourg CSSF, and United States SEC & NFA. REGULATORY RESEARCH This part of the role will involve researching new financial regulatory requirements in order to assist in the development and delivery of regulatory reporting services.
